The Alaska Wildlife and Bird Photography River Expedition is a 7-day float trip on a pristine and remote Alaskan river with gourmet amenities and first-rate wildlife viewing opportunites.
This expedition offers close access to the wildlife and birds of Alaska, as we float silently through the remote wilderness in expedition grade rafts handled by expert naturalist/river guides.
Knowledgeable guides assist with species identification, wildlife photography instruction, your personalized photography curriculum and natural history interpretation.

Itinerary
7-Day Alaska
Wildlife & Bird Photography River Expedition
Day 1-6
Meet guides in Anchorage at Lake Hood Float Plane Airport for short flight to river put-in. Prepare raft gear, wilderness safety orientation, begin floating river.
Gourmet meals prepared by guides at camp and on river (lunches.)
Early evening photography instruction/critique sessions at camp. Instruction given when we encounter wildlife. Expedition grade tent accommodations.
Day 7
Early morning camp departure, Float river until early afternoon. Break gear down at takeout. Meet our pickup airplane for flight back to Anchorage, arriving around dinner time. End Expedition.
